Continental American Insurance Company is a firm that provides insurance to nonprofit clients. They operate nationwide, with nonprofit clients using their services across the country.
Most Continental American Insurance Company clients are hospitals, outpatient health care practitioners and facilities, and colleges, universities, and professional schools with revenues ranging from $31 million to $424 million.
